  • NIFAIS go live – Monday 4th September 2023

    Topics:
    • Northern Ireland Food Animal Information System (NIFAIS)

    Date published: 29 August 2023

    The countdown is on for NIFAIS Go Live on Monday 4th September 2023.

    SCreenshot of Northern Ireland Food Animal Information System

    NIFAIS is one of the largest IT changes which the Department has introduced in recent years. The first stage of NIFAIS was implemented in 2017 and the remaining bovine functionality will now go live on 4th September 2023. NIFAIS will eventually replace APHIS as the Department’s key traceability and disease control system underpinning the agri-food sector in Northern Ireland.

    External Stakeholders using their Government Gateway / NIDA log in details, will be taken to the new NIFAIS landing page where all services can be accessed.

    A reduced APHIS remains available for other species and will be supported until NIFAIS stage 2 is successfully delivered.
